Mode of transportation doesnt matter. Travelled by car as well as flew. No issues in using avr.
Also there is no preference mode which gets special treatment. So just go with the one that is convenient.

Why do you want to go with someone you dont know?
Here is the issue: Some officers from US side ask on why you travel together and how do you know each other, why you travel together and so on. I dont know about Canadian side as i have not heard these issues from my colleagues yet but definitely US side the guys analyze the risk of unrelated persons who travel together.

I have my colleagues coming from windsor but i am avoiding traveling together except during car trouble days to avoid unnecessary profiling/questioning from cbp.

Its your call.
